My wife and I have been practicing male chastity for several years and we’ve tried many variations for keyholding, always with an emphasis on safety, but also keeping things as secure as possible. There’s a lot of writing online about keyholders completely controlling access to keys, or of the partner in chastity having absolutely no access to any key. For the purpose of safety, this could lay the groundwork for a potential disaster in the event of a medical emergency or other event which interferes with the chaste male’s ability to access their key in an emergency. My wife and I have found some middle ground here which I’ll share with you in this post.

Using a Sealed Envelope

This is probably the simplest safeguard. With this method, the keyholder can hold the main key, but the chaste male can keep a spare on them in a sealed envelope. I’d suggest having the keyholder sign the sealed part of the envelope so that it’s obvious if it’s been opened. This way, the chaste male will have access to an emergency key, but will also be held accountable to his partner to ensure that he doesn’t unlock himself for anything other than an emergency.

Keeping an Emergency Key in an Inconvenient Location

This option is actually quite convenient as it doesn’t require any extra items or apparatus. The emergency key is simply held someplace which is inconvenient to access, like inside of a small pouch tucked away in a backpack or drawer. It creates the sense of being without access to the key, but the inconvenience of how to access the emergency key is enough of a deterrent to prevent the chaste male from making the effort.

Storing the Emergency Key in a Locked Portable Container

This is our preferred method. I will often keep the emergency key inside of a small pouch which is locked with a small padlock with my wife holding the key to the padlock. This prevents me from accessing the emergency key as I will need to ask her for the padlock key to be able to access the emergency key in the pouch. However, in a true emergency in which she’s unavailable, I can also use scissors or a knife to rip apart the travel pouch to access the emergency key. This creates a suitable enough deterrent and also makes it clear that my wife truly controls the key, the chastity cage, and my cock.

Summary

No matter how strong a fantasy you have about being locked in chastity and throwing away the key, that’s never a good idea. You should always have a safe and reliable backup plan providing for access to a key in an emergency. The actual practice of male chastity is more mental than physical, and the chastity cage is more of a deterrent, and is largely symbolic. It’s much better to be safe than to risk being unable to remove your chastity cage in a true emergency.
